The 2023–24 Qatar Stars League, or the QSL, also called Expo Stars League for sponsorship reasons, was the 50th edition of top-level football championship in Qatar.

Quick facts Season, Champions ...

Al-Duhail were the defending champions.[1]

Foreign players

Clubs can register a total of seven foreign players over the course of the season, provided that two of them do not exceed the age of 23 (born in 2000 and under).[2]
